The Bayelsa State Police Command has informed the general public that a new Commissioner of the Police has been posted to the State. He is CP Alonyenu Francis Idu.

In a statement by CSP Asinim Butswat Police Public Relations Officer, Bayelsa State Command said the new CP has officially assumed duty as the 37th Commissioner of Police, Bayelsa state Command, having taken over from CP Tolani H. Alausa, who has been redeployed to the Force Headquarters, Abuja.

The CP hails from Benue State and was appointed to the Nigeria Police Force in 1992 as cadet Assistant Superintendent of Police.
He is a seasoned Police Officer with vast experience in Operations, such as; Police Mobile Force, Insurgency and Banditry Operations, Investigation in Counter Terrorism, Fraud and other Money laundering Related Crimes.
The CP solicited for the Cooperation of the good people of Bayelsa state.

He also assured that the Police Command under his watch, will ensure protection of Lives and property, guarantee public safety and sustain social Harmony.
